<h2 style="font-weight: bold; margin: 12px 0;">The Cultural Significance of Bàu Trúc Pottery</h2>

Bàu Trúc pottery holds immense cultural significance in Vietnam, serving as a tangible link to the country's rich heritage. The art form has played a vital role in shaping the cultural identity of the region, reflecting the values, beliefs, and traditions of the local community. The pottery has been an integral part of daily life, used for cooking, serving food, storing water, and decorating homes. It has also been used in religious ceremonies and festivals, symbolizing the connection between the past, present, and future.

<h2 style="font-weight: bold; margin: 12px 0;">The Economic Value of Bàu Trúc Pottery</h2>

Beyond its cultural significance, Bàu Trúc pottery also holds significant economic value. The art form has become a source of income for many local artisans, contributing to the economic well-being of the community. The pottery is highly sought after by both domestic and international collectors, with its unique aesthetic and historical significance driving its market value. The increasing demand for Bàu Trúc pottery has led to the development of workshops and studios, creating employment opportunities and fostering economic growth in the region.
